Description
This course has been designed to provide you with an overview of the commonly used NDT methods.
It will help you to better understand the important role of NDT in the engineering design process and how NDT is used to monitor the condition of your assets.
We will explain how the methods work and where they are used in industrial settings. This will help you identify the relevant methods applicable to your assets and the benefits that each can provide. You will gain an understanding of strengths and limitations of each method to assist you in selecting the most effective, efficient and reliable NDT test.
This course covers the basic theory of each method, common test applications and basic practical experience of equipment in general use.
